"Move! Move! Make way up front!"

On the jeep, guards were shouting loudly, signaling the soldiers in front not to block the way. The driver was frantically honking the horn, and people on the road hurriedly scattered, looking dissatisfied and muttered a few words, grumbling.

Beside him, General Alex Phillips was stiff-faced with a cigarette in his mouth, emanating a gloomy aura.

Damn, not firing a single shot and just running away—he still felt a surge of anger pressing on his chest.

The future War God of Mexico!

"Order the troops to speed up, set up a second line of defense at Cadreta!"

"Brigade commander, it's too late, the Northern Army's tanks are already behind us," cried an aide-de-camp next to him.

No sooner had he finished his words than gunfire was heard from behind, followed by the fearful cries of the soldiers, "Hurry up, move, they're catching up."

Many, not knowing what to do, blindly followed and ran forward. Suddenly, the formation of the troops was a mess, and they scurried to escape.

Alex Phillips was equally afraid. What good could come of being captured?

He kept urging the driver, who also became fierce, stepping on the gas pedal, ramming anything in front out of the way!

But clearly, their luck was not good; there was a sharp descent ahead that the driver didn't see, and the vehicle suddenly flew into the air and then crashed heavily to the ground. The car, unstable, flipped over!

The Chief of Staff crawled out from inside, screaming heartbreakingly, clutching his fractured arm, wailing mournfully.

"Brigade commander? Brigade commander! Quick, save the brigade commander!" he sat on the ground, urgently calling to the soldiers.

When the guards who arrived from behind lifted the jeep, Brigade Commander Alex Phillips was folded in an odd position on the seat, his neck twisted at a 110° angle, eyes bulging out, half his tongue hanging out.

Glass shards were embedded all over his face, one piece severely piercing through his neck.

By the time he was lifted out, there was no sign of life.

Alex Phillips' doppelganger was Walton Walker, dubbed the "U.S. General of Cavalry." Soon, the two could discuss their manner of death together down below.

Deprived of their "father," the morale of the 61st Brigade worsened. Under the leadership of the Chief of Staff, they continued the "breakout," but they didn't forget to send word back to the South, hoping to contact the Popovich Government for help with the retreat.

The routes in the Northern State were too treacherous.

Southern. Yucatan Island.

Los Zetas Commander, the Southern Government's new 24-year-old Defense Minister, Arturo Desena, was in his own office…

Playing computer games.

Civilization (Microprose)!

Oh, right, this game was produced by an American game company. Sid Meier is the lead designer and president, but if someone paid close attention, they could see an investment company, "New World Capital."

This company was established in 1989 in Silicon Valley, investing in the likes of Apple, the World Wide Web (WWW), Wells Fargo, Coca-Cola, and many internet companies, with investments totaling 600 million US Dollars!

They were Silicon Valley's new "Red Man."

There were always people lining up outside the door.

The boss was a white man.

Ten years later, let's see how much these are worth!

But the boss of "New World Capital" was actually "Capesay Bank," registered in Brazil, which mainly dealt with insurance and cargo loans. The bank had over thirteen shareholders, all with unheard names.

Among them, a company holding 1.2%, called "New Hope" Group, established by Vic's white-glove Best!

The remaining companies were actually shell companies, with the ultimate principals all being either a battalion or company commander from the Northern Army. So, in reality, the behind-the-scenes boss was Victor!

The Southern Government's head honcho's game was invented by a company established by his opponent, stimulating when you think about it.

So, the Northern Government might be strapped for cash, but Victor… wasn't necessarily poor.

Just as Arturo Desena was engrossed in his game, he heard urgent knocking. He turned his head, frowning, pressed pause, swiveled his chair, "Come in."

"Boss… uh, Defense Minister, we have an urgent message from the 61st Brigade." The man entering was Arturo Desena's right-hand man, Endric Vinicius, nicknamed "Fox," the second-in-command of Los Zetas.

He used to be a street thug, then went to Colombia for "further education," later joined the Mexico Police Headquarters as the head of the Anti-drug Combat Department!

Now he serves as the Southern Government's "Deputy Defense Minister" and "Minister of Foreign Affairs."

He was nearly 20 years older than Arturo Desena, but he didn't hesitate to call him boss. It was indeed a great undertaking, but the other party preferred the use of official titles during work.

"Boss, boss" made the team look very informal.

Endric Vinicius passed over the document in his hands. Once Desena took it, he hastily said, "The 61st Brigade encountered artillery fire from the Northern Army's Marine Fourth Division in Nuevo Leon State. Despite a valiant resistance, there was a traitor among the Monterrey people. General Alex Phillips led his troops in retreat and fought against the Northern Army near the Kroso River. He personally led a counter-charge, killed over 20 enemy soldiers, and then fell in battle!"

Arturo Desena, looking at the document in his hands, felt each word shining brightly, quite blinding. He fell silent for a moment. "How did he really die?"

He didn't believe a single word in there.

Alex Phillips fight to the death?

Do you know what his nickname was?

"The Korean Male of North America!"
